Ubraj Narine

Pt. Ubraj Narine (born 12 October 1991)[1] is a Guyanese politician, paralegal and Hindu priest who is the Mayor of Georgetown, Guyana. He was elected in the November 2018 local government elections to represent Constituency 1 in the City Council and was subsequently elected as Mayor by the city council and re-elected in 2019 and 2020.[2][3][4]
